Считается число «успешных» статусов. Код: cnt = 0; цикл for st in ['ok', 'cancelled', 'ok']:; если st == 'cancelled', выполняется continue, иначе cnt += 1. Чему равно cnt?

A1
B3
C0
D2
Правильный ответ. continue пропускает текущую итерацию и переходит к следующей.

Разбор

На втором элементе 'cancelled' сработает continue, поэтому cnt не увеличится. Для двух значений 'ok' счётчик увеличится, итоговое значение cnt будет 2.

Проверь себя · 1/3разбор после ответа
Есть словарь выручки по странам revenue_by_country = {'RU': 100, 'KZ': 50}. Как корректно посчитать сумму значений через цикл for?
Тренировать Python в Telegram

Ещё вопросы по теме «Циклы и условия»